Going out dancing in Viterbo and its surrounding province is an increasingly popular option for those looking to combine nightlife with a lively, social atmosphere. Although the area isn’t as large as other Italian cities, it’s common to find dance events scattered throughout Viterbo and nearby towns, as well as in nearby areas like Civita Castellana, Tarquinia, or even day trips to Rome.
Depending on the night, many venues offer a variety of music: from Latin rhythms like salsa and bachata to more commercial sets or mixes with reggaeton. The lineup usually changes every week, so it’s common for the same venue to feature different styles depending on the day or event.
The atmosphere is usually quite social and open. If you hit the dance floor, it’s easy to see people switching partners, laughing, and learning from one another. Going alone is completely normal and, in fact, one of the best ways to meet new people while dancing. You don’t need to come in a group to have a good time.
As for the vibe, many nights start off laid-back and pick up as the hours go by. It’s common to find cover charges that include a drink or similar deals, depending on the venue and event.
